HR 4149 111th Congress House Taxation Alternative and renewable resources Electric power generation and transmission Income tax credits Public utilities and utility rates

To amend the Internal Revenue Code of 1986 to provide a renewable electricity integration credit for a utility that purchases or produces renewable power.

Introduced: November 19, 2009 See on congress.gov

 Plain-English summary Congressional Research Service

Amends the Internal Revenue Code to allow electric utilities a business-related tax credit for producing and selling specified percentages of renewable electricity generated by wind and solar energy facilities.
